Start by thinking about your ideal day on the water. Are you picturing a relaxing sail around the harbor or an adventurous trip toward Catalina Island?
We offer both bareboat and captained charters. If you're an experienced sailor with the proper credentials, a bareboat charter gives you full control. Otherwise, a captained charter with one of our experienced captains ensures a safe, enjoyable time without the pressure of navigating.
Not all boats are the same, and neither are your needs. Our fleet includes a range of well-maintained catamarans and Motor Yachts, each suited to different group sizes and preferences.
For smaller groups or family outings, a modest-sized vessel works well. For larger company outings or special events, ask about options that offer more seating, open deck space, and indoor kitchens.

Every sailing charter includes the essentials, but knowing what’s onboard helps with planning. Safety gear is standard across our fleet, including life jackets and first-aid equipment.
We also provide ice chests for your drinks and food items—just bring your refreshments. Keep in mind, we don’t allow glass containers onboard. Our boats follow federal regulations, and safety is our top priority.
Choose a route that matches your mood. Some charters stay close to Newport Beach, giving you a laid-back tour of the coastline. Others set course for Catalina Island, Dana Point, or even farther, depending on the trip length.

Bring layers. Even in sunny Southern California, ocean breezes can get chilly. Don’t forget sunscreen and a hat.
Arrive early to meet your crew and go over the plan. Captained charters often include a brief walkthrough of safety procedures before departure.
Rental pricing depends on the size of the boat, duration, and whether you choose a bareboat or captained charter. Expect variations based on the season and type of trip.
Extra services like Extra Hours or adventure charters may affect the total. We don’t offer food or drink packages, but your group is welcome to bring snacks and a selection of beverages—just no glass.
